A Look At Online Forex Brokers
By: Eddie Tobey
An online forex broker is a firm that facilitates retail trading using Internet
technologies. Global Forex Trading (GFT), one of the popular online forex
brokers. It provides retail traders with a free demo trading account, allows
users to open a live account, gives live help, provides software called DealBook
FX 2, and allows viewing of account documents. (DealBook FX 2 can be downloaded
for the demo trading account).
Gain Capital Group’s Online Forex offers 200:1 leverage. In some cases, the
total return on investment is higher due to leverage. For example, with $1000
cash in a margin account, the investor can control up to $200,000 in notional
value. Of course, trading on leverage magnifies both the investor’s profits and
losses.
GCI Financial Ltd. offers commission-free online trading in forex. GCI offers
Internet trading software, fast and efficient execution, and 0.5% margin
requirements. This broker offers USD or Euro denominated trading accounts. The
spreads are 3 pips in EUR/USD and USD/JPY, and are 4 to 5 pips for other major
commissions. Clients can hedge by opening positions in the same currency in
opposite directions. Risk to the investor is limited to the deposited funds.
Market analysis and research, real-time charts, and forex trading signals are
available at no charge.
ACM, part of the REFCO group, offers 3 pip spreads on all major currencies,
which works out to between 0.02% and 0.03% on the dollar value. They also offer
commission-free trading, and forex trading with a 1% margin, which means that a
trader can control $1,000,000 with $10,000 in his account.
There are many online forex brokers that offer free demo accounts for potential
forex traders to practice trading. It is only a matter of registering and
starting demo trading to get a feel for forex trading. In addition, at most
sites, traders can find free forex news to assist them with their trade
strategies.
